Using the above test case fixed the bug. Additionally, I tested adding and deleting rules with and without --dry-run enabled and it works as expected.
-- [SRU] ufw adds rules to chains when --dry-run is specified https://bugs.launchpad.net/bugs/247352 You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. -- ubuntu-bugs mailing list [email protected] https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s
